diff options
author | Martin Blapp <mbr@FreeBSD.org> | 2003-02-23 15:08:25 +0000 |
---|---|---|
committer | Martin Blapp <mbr@FreeBSD.org> | 2003-02-23 15:08:25 +0000 |
commit | 3e47836f1ae7018acb7a82345db3f734949087ef (patch) | |
tree | d1018bb8dad5681de27302f31a9fb35d6328861c /databases/mysql55-server/Makefile | |
parent | 4de00373de96d9e0195e99d56ea29a22908d40ae (diff) | |
download | ports-3e47836f1ae7018acb7a82345db3f734949087ef.tar.gz ports-3e47836f1ae7018acb7a82345db3f734949087ef.zip |
Notes
Diffstat (limited to 'databases/mysql55-server/Makefile')
-rw-r--r-- | databases/mysql55-server/Makefile |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/databases/mysql55-server/Makefile b/databases/mysql55-server/Makefile index ab8f13da92e2..00fd6e4621f2 100644 --- a/databases/mysql55-server/Makefile +++ b/databases/mysql55-server/Makefile @@ -66,6 +66,14 @@ CONFIGURE_ARGS+=--with-mysqld-ldflags=-all-static .if defined(BUILD_OPTIMIZED) CFLAGS+= -mcpu=i686 .endif +.if defined(WITH_LINUXTHREADS) +CONFIGURE_ARGS+=--with-named-thread-libs='-DHAVE_GLIBC2_STYLE_GETHOSTBYNAME_R +CONFIGURE_ARGS+=-D_THREAD_SAFE -I${LOCALBASE}/include/pthread/linuxthreads +CONFIGURE_ARGS+=-L${LOCALBASE}/lib -llthread -llgcc_r' +CFLAGS+= -D__USE_UNIX98 -D_REENTRANT -D_THREAD_SAFE +CFLAGS+= -I${LOCALBASE}/include/pthread/linuxthreads +LIB_DEPENDS+= lthread.2:${PORTSDIR}/devel/linuxthreads +.endif .if defined(THREAD_SAFE_CLIENT) CONFIGURE_ARGS+=--enable-thread-safe-client .endif @@ -102,6 +110,7 @@ pre-fetch: @${ECHO} " WITH_OPENSSL=yes Enable secure connections." @${ECHO} " DB_DIR=directory Set alternate directory for database files" @${ECHO} " (default is /var/db/mysql)." + @${ECHO} " WITH_LINUXTHREADS=yes Use the linuxthreads pthread library." @${ECHO} " OVERWRITE_DB=yes Re-initialize default databases" @${ECHO} " SKIP_DNS_CHECK=yes Don't run resolveip to do an additional" @${ECHO} " DNS check before inserting local hostname to" |